Amino acid, no-maybe: You need phenylalanine in your diet as it is one of the essential amino acids that you cannot make. However, in this case the reason it is likely listed on the package is because the product probably has aspartame (an artificial sweetener that contains phenylalanine) in it and by law foods with aspartame must list it to warn people with the rare disease phenylketonuria that it has phenylalanine.
